I just got my Tein H-tech springs to put in, and went ahead and took the front strut off. When I bought the car, they just had KYB GR-2's put on, so I figured I would be ok. But when I took the stut off, I realized all there is is the black dust cover, no bumpstop. I didn't get to looking at the other ones to see if they were missing, but was wondering if I needed these? I could see if I was lowering the car a lot, but since I am not I was wondering if they were necessary.
 
I only lowered my car about an inch, but I re-used my stock bumpstops by cutting off the smallest section on the end. My car doesn't sit that low (well... for a lowered car) but it still goes through potholes and bumps, since this is Maine.

If I were you, I'd pull them out of a local junkyard, or pick some up from a local auto store.
 
Bumpstops are neccessary to prevent your suspension hitting metal on metal on drastic changes. How could you NOT need them?
